Introduction
AUDITZ is the centralized audit log and audit-trail layer within PLTFRMS.
It provides a single, secure system for collecting, storing, and verifying audit events across all services — ensuring integrity, traceability, and consistency without requiring each service to maintain its own audit trail.
What is AUDITZ?
AUDITZ enables you to:
- Capture audit events from distributed services
- Ingest events through topic-based streams
- Store audit data in a centralized and consistent format
- Ensure data integrity and tamper resistance
- Provide queryable and verifiable audit history
- Support internal, external, and customer-driven audits
All audit events flow into AUDITZ, where they are securely processed and stored as a trusted source of truth.
Why AUDITZ exists
In traditional architectures, each service is responsible for its own audit trail. This leads to:
- Fragmented and inconsistent audit data
- Difficulties in ensuring data integrity
- High implementation overhead per service
- Increased risk of missing or altered audit records
AUDITZ solves this by centralizing audit responsibility into a single platform, ensuring that audit data is handled consistently and securely across the entire system.

Event-driven architecture
AUDITZ is built around an event-driven model.
Audit events are:
- Published by services via topics
- Ingested in real-time by AUDITZ
- Processed and stored centrally
- Made available for querying and audit workflows
This ensures a scalable and decoupled architecture that integrates easily into existing systems.
